Diseño de teoría de colas en cines y teatros bajo la nueva normativa del Ministerio de Salud en Colombia para la atención de usuarios con el objetivo de evitar la propagación del virus COVID-19

Abstract

El trabajo presentado realiza un estudio de servicio con énfasis en el diseño de operaciones para los cines y teatros de la ciudad de Bogotá; a partir de una investigación de modelos matemáticos como es la teoría de colas, el objetivo es evaluar la capacidad de líneas de espera a partir de la norma establecida por el gobierno de la Republica y el Ministerio de Salud y poder afrontar la propagación del COVID-19, este virus siendo el principal causante de muertes durante el año 2020 en Colombia y responsable del cierre de servicios masivos debido a su alto rango de contagio entre los seres humanos, a partir de esto, se demostrará como esta implementado un modelo cualitativo como protocolo de salud donde se adquirió información pertinente para el estudio del caso. Así mismo, validar si el sistema es optimo respecto a las capacidades exigidas por el gobierno, lo que permitirá dar una recomendación a los usuarios a pesar de la posible vulnerabilidad del servicio y a través de este trabajo promocionar que es posible garantizar servicios masivos respetando la salud y el bienestar de los interesados. Por otra parte, existen posibles mejoras dando uso de mecanismos de servicio de modelos de redes de colas y modelos como MM1 y MMC donde verificarán de manera mas teórica la prestación y la distribución de las salas de cine, teniendo siempre como objetivo el cuidado y evitar posibles propagaciones del virus. The work presented will conduct a service study with emphasis on the design of cinemas and theatres operations in the city of Bogota; from an investigation of mathematical models such as queuing theory, the objective is to evaluate the capacity of waiting lines from the government standard and the Ministry of Health to address the spread of COVID-19, this virus being the main cause of deaths during the year 2020 in Colombia and responsible for the closure of services to its high range of contagion among humans, from this, it will be shown how this implemented a qualitative model as a health protocol where relevant information was acquired for the study case. Moreover, to validate if the system is optimal with respect to the capacities required by the government, which will allow giving a recommendation to the users despite the possible vulnerability of the service and through this work to promote that it is possible to guarantee massive services respecting the health and well-being of the interested parties.
